Cinéma du look in all its glory. A subterranean community of refugees seeks safety in maze-like subway tunnels, which become a temporary home for Fred, who has stolen important documents incriminating the wrong person. Hunted by gangsters and police, Fred tries to settle down beneath Paris streets, falls in love with the wife of the man who put a price on his head and jams with a garage band. Besson infuses Subway with allusions to films by himself, Jean-Luc Godard and Batman comics. It may be pop culture clutter, but it sparkles with all requisite colours.

Luc Besson (b. 1959) – French director, screenwriter, and producer. He planned to become a marine biologist, but a diving accident made this impossible, which has proved fortunate for the art of filmmaking. Raised on comics and television since he was a child, Besson turned his attention to photography and, later, cinema, sketching plots of his future hits in a notebook. After finishing school, he undertook a short internship in Hollywood, where he began working in the film industry on both short and feature films, later becoming an assistant director at the Gaumont Film Company, where he worked with Lewis Gilbert, Clive Donner, Claude Faraldo, and Patrick Grandperret, among others. He founded his own production company in 1981, where he did advertising work. His debut in the science fiction genre, The Last Battle (1983), brought him several international awards. His style follows closely that of Hollywood, making him stand out among other French filmmakers. From the mid-1980s to the early 1990s, Besson has been a standout member of an informal artistic movement called cinéma du look or French Neo-Baroque.
